Leftist bid to 'reframe' 250th birthday narrative reunites Women's March squad
Linda Sarsour, who previously faced controversy over antisemitic remarks and left the Women's March, is now planning to reunite key figures from the movement for a leftist effort to reshape the narrative surrounding the nation's 250th birthday. This move has sparked interest and debate, especially given the divisive nature of her past actions and the broader implications for the movement's future direction. It signals a significant attempt to rebrand and refocus the group's agenda, potentially drawing renewed attention and controversy.
